The idea of a national guilt complex is a complex one, often analyzed in the context of history and sociological trends. It suggests that a nation as a whole may carry a burden of guilt for past actions, even if those actions were committed by a subset within its population. This possibility can manifest in various ways, such as a fixation with atonement, or a sense of collective shame that affects national identity and actions.
